Research shows that with the appropriate support, all students can be successful learners. Some students face more challenges than others as they learn to read, write and do mathematics. Limestone District School Board offers various programs to address these needs.

  • Please see the links below for more specific information on these student support programs.

  • Math Homework Help: A free, live, online math tutoring from an Ontario teacher for students in Grades 7-10 who need help with math homework.

  • Remedial Literacy: Lunch-time and after-school remedial programming for language literacy for students in Grades 9-10. Please contact your school to inquire if this program is available.

  • Remedial Numeracy: Lunch-time and after-school remedial programming for mathematical literacy for students in Grades 9-10. Please contact your school to inquire if this program is available.

  • Right to Read: An after school program for small groups of students in Grades 2-6 who would benefit from additional practice with higher level reading and thinking skills.

  • Spring Literacy Tutors: A program for students in Grades 7-10 who require remedial literacy support.
